What to check before for buildings highly rated for heat near the 4 train in NYC

  • Focus your search on the 4 train area, then prioritize the “best heat” filter to surface buildings with stronger heat-related feedback.
  • Before signing, ask how heat is controlled (radiators vs. central), how often maintenance responds, and what happens during extreme cold snaps.
  • Confirm the practical details: the exact start/end dates for heat season, after-hours maintenance access, and how complaints are logged.
  • If utilities are separate or partially billed, confirm the full monthly cost (utilities, deposit, and any fees) and how heating impacts budgeting.
  • Compare multiple buildings side-by-side using the review and Q&A signals, not just the asking price or building appearance.
